Coordinate input device
First Claim
1. A transparent coordinate input device comprising:
- a transparent insulating substrate;
a flat transparent resistor film of a rectangular shape on said substrate;
detection electrodes, electrically connected to four sides of said transparent resistor film, for causing a current to flow along one of current flow-in or flow-out directions with respect to said transparent resistor film;
a transparent protective layer on an upper surface of said transparent resistor film and having a planar resistance substantially higher than the resistance in the direction of the thickness thereof;
a conductive electrical pane for specifiying an input position on said transparent resistor film;
a DC power source circuit, electrically connected to said electrical pen, for supplying a DC drive current to said transparent resistor film from the input position; and
detecting means, connected to said detection electrodes, for detecting coordinates of the input position specified by said electrical pen in accordance with outputs from said detection electrodes.

Abstract
A transparent coordinate input device can be used integrally with a display unit or overlap it and has a coordinate input panel (i.e., a transparent drawing pad). The input panel has a transparent insulating substrate, a flat transparent resistor film of a rectangular shape which is formed on the substrate, and detection electrodes, electrically connected to four sides of the transparent resistor film, for causing a current to flow along one of current flow-in and flow-out directions with respect to the transparent resistor film. The transparent coordinate input device also has a coordinate correction table for storing correction data representing the relationship between the input coordinate signals representing an input position of the electrical pen and the output coordinate signals representing a position and detected by a detector, and an operation circuit for performing coordinate correction by accessing the coordinate correction table.
